Some 150 years ago, brothers Jacob and Frederick Beringer left Germany to found a winery and distillery in Napa. Reusing their spirit barrels to age wine just seemed like good financial sense, but they quickly discovered it added a whole new level of complexity. Today, Beringer Bros. honors Jacob and Frederick’s pioneering spirit by aging Beringer Bros. wines in spirit barrels. Old Elk Distillery’s New Limited-Edition Expression

Old Elk Distillery, Fort Collins, unveil new limited edition expression, Old Elk Infinity Blend. Created by Master Distiller, Greg Metze, Infinity Blend is the marriage of 60% Old Elk’s signature high malt bourbon with 24% 12 Year Old Kentucky Vintage and 16% 11-Year-Old Kentucky Vintage

“The Infinity bottle concept is something you’re familiar with if you’re into whiskey – people are experimenting with their own bottles at home, and we wanted to give them something to add to their collection,” states Luis Gonzalez, CEO. “This particular expression speaks to our team’s interest and creativity to create our very own version of an Infinity bottle, led by our flagship bourbon and blended with Kentucky vintage bourbons, for our company and brand. We are inspired daily by Greg, his influence on the industry to date, what he’s created, and also the promise of the future core products and innovative blends of Old Elk.”

Old Elk’s Infinity Blend will be distributed by Southern Glazer’s Wine & Spirits and will be a national limited release, available at select retailers in the U.S. with a suggested retail price of $149.99 per 750 ml bottle.

Far Niente Family of Wineries and Vineyards Acquires Provenance Vineyards Facility

Napa Valley luxury wine producer Far Niente Family of Wineries and Vineyards (FNFWV) acquired the former Provenance Vineyards winery in Rutherford, Calif.  Far Niente said it intends to repurpose the hospitality and production areas as a home for its Bella Union Napa Valley Cabernet label, with a projected opening in early 2023.

“We have been searching for a home for Bella Union that will enable us to provide our wines and experiences to consumers and the trade and more fully tell the story of Bella Union, which we introduced with the 2012 vintage from our vineyard holdings in Rutherford.  We are thrilled with the acquisition of this site for its exceptional visibility and access in Rutherford along Highway 29, and the location next to DeCarle Vineyard, one of our primary sources for the Bella Union Napa Valley Cabernet blend,” said Steve Spadarotto, Far Niente CEO.

Bella Union specializes in the art of blending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on. Initially sourced exclusively from a 25-acre vineyard along Bella Oaks Lane, Bella Union remains rooted in Rutherford, but the Cabernet blend has evolved to include complementary vineyards from Calistoga, Oak Knoll and Yountville.

“My aim when crafting our Bella Union Napa Valley Cabernet is to weave together the personalities of each vineyard in the blend to produce the most harmonious wine,” said Winemaker Brooke Price, who served as assistant winemaker at Nickel & Nickel prior to taking the helm at Bella Union. The winery’s first harvest in the new facility will commence in 2022.

The Provenance Vineyards brand and inventory was purchased by Thomas Allen Wine Estates of Lodi, Calif., and joins its portfolio with Hook Or Crook Cellars.

Zepponi & Company served as the exclusive financial advisor to Treasury Wine Estates Americas Company. Farella, Braun + Martel advised FNFWV on the transaction.

FMB/Seltzers Continue to Fall, Imports Gain in NBWA Beer Purchasers’ Index

The FMB/seltzer segment continued to see significant declines in the National Beer Wholesalers Association‘s Beer Purchasers Index this summer. This segment took another big hit, falling 48 points from 92 in October 2020 to 44 in October 2021.

The index for imports continued into expansion territory with a reading of 69 in October 2021, which is about the same as the reading in October 2020.

The craft index posted a reading of 43 for October 2021, compared to a reading of 51 in October 2020. This is the second monthly reading below 50.

The premium lights index posted a reading of 52 for October 2021, well below the October 2020 reading of 67. Premium lights continue to post index readings at or above the 50 mark in 2021.

The regular domestic beer segment index posted a reading of 42 for October 2021, which is significantly below the October 2020 reading of 53.

The below premium segment weighed in at 30, taking another significant hit from last October’s reading of 48.

Finally, the cider segment remained below 50, with a reading of 29 in October 2021, compared to 44 in October 2020.
